   I have come to the conclusion that people’s actions are not as much a   
   function of their character or personality as it is a function of their   
   beliefs.   
      
   Under Nazism, even the better people behaved in horrible ways because they   
   were practicing a horrible ideology. When that ideology was dispensed with,   
   these same people created a beautiful, peaceful and prosperous country that   
   has exercised a positive    
   role in world affairs. It is unlikely that the whole population changed its   
   character in short time between one and the other. What changed was their   
   beliefs.   
      
   We see some interesting things with feminism. There was one form of feminism   
   in 1960s and 1970s, and completely another in 1990s. The first cultivated the   
   character of compassionate, generous and free-spirited hippie idealism. The   
   second cultivated the    
   character of the harpy. The same people were involved in both. Once again,   
   their innate character did not change; what changed was their beliefs.   
      
   I have watched the same people act in completely different ways depending on   
   what they believed. I have found that the people who were caught in the   
   ideology of survival and competition became mean and were always freaking out.   
   This is the case with even    
   the best people. When they no longer had those beliefs, the change in behavior   
   followed.    
      
   People’s actions are therefore a function of things that drive their   
   behavior. A vast amount of behavior is owed to beliefs. Which means that to   
   correctly impact upon people’s behavior it is necessary to work with their   
   beliefs.   
      
   How much of people’s actions is character and how much it is belief? And how   
   do the two relate to each other? What is the seed and what is the soil? What   
   is the relationship between nature and nurture?   
      
   These questions need to be asked across the board so that insight be achieved.
